iPhone with holographic screen concept looks amazing

Apple has recently scored a patent for a holographic screen, prompting one designer to show us how an iPhone equipped with this technology could look like. And what he came up with is nothing short of amazing.

While we’re sure a phone with this technology is still years away, it is kinda nice to look more years to the future.

The concept you’re video about to see was designed by Mike Ko, who has created animations for big companies/brands like Google, Nike, Toyota and NASCAR.

The short clip, called Diorama, features a small car riding around the city with objects and people popping-up up along the ride. It’s pretty sweet. Check it out.
